The forum on the experience of Turkmen neutrality in Beijing

The capital of the People’s Republic of China hosted the scientific conference “Turkmenistan-China: the Great Silk Road – the Road of Friendship and Cooperation”. The forum was organized by the Embassy of Turkmenistan in the People’s Republic of China jointly with the Dungan Studies Centre at the China Central University for Nationalities and the Beijing Association for the Development Studies of Nationalities.

The representative forum organized within the framework of the events on occasion of the 20th anniversary of neutrality of Turkmenistan brought together specialists of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the People’s Republic of China, representatives of public research institutes and business organisations, officials of the Embassy of Turkmenistan in China, the Chinese People’s Association for Friendship with Foreign Countries, Turkmen students, who study at higher educational institutions in China, members of the delegation of Turkmenistan and the media.

Those speaking at the conference, including former Ambassador of the People’s Republic of China to Turkmenistan Mr. Yin Songling and the former Ambassador of the People’s Republic of China to the Kyrgyz Republic and the Republic of Uzbekistan Mr. Zhang Zhiming, noted that the favourable geographical and geopolitical location of Turkmenistan, its role as a neutral peace-loving state had made our country a mediator between East and West and a unique region in Central Asia leading in the stabilization and integration processes on the vast space. The past 20 years have proved the effectiveness of the Turkmen model of neutrality in the life of the country as well as in the international arena, where Turkmenistan performs its constructive and peacekeeping functions.


The presentations on the history of Turkmen-Chinese relations, the age-old traditions of a mutually respectful dialogue between our nations and key aspects of the interstate cooperation at the present stage were presented during the forum. The reports made by the professors at the Central University for Nationalities Mr. Hu Zhenhua and Ms. Minawer Habibullah on the history of Kunya Urgench cultural and humanitarian contacts aroused particular interest among conference participants.

It was underlined that the year of 2014 was marked by the successful state visit of the Turkmen leader to China that became another important stage in relationships between our countries. The top-level talks spotlighted the strategic vectors and identified a number of specific long-term objectives.

The participants in the forum were unanimous that the mutual willingness of Turkmenistan and China to enhance political, political, economic, cultural and humanitarian ties as well as the profound positive experience of joint work for more than 20 years contributed to building up interstate relations. That is vividly prove by dozens of ambitious joint projects of national and international significance, including the project of the 21st century -Turkmenistan-China gas pipeline that serves as the strategic transnational energy bridge.

The forum participants discussed the Turkmen-Chinese cooperation within the project on creation of the Silk Road Economic Belt Initiative “One Road. One Belt”, which covers all Asian countries located on the perimeter of the Pacific Ocean, and aims at promoting trade and financial support to the countries located on the belt as well as building up cooperation on energy security, expanding partnership in infrastructure development, investment activity and cultural and innovation exchange. In this regard, emphasis was placed on the importance of on-going fruitful work carrying out by our countries in order to revive the ancient Silk Road on a qualitatively new level in the format of multifaceted cooperation and develop modern transnational road, rail and pipeline routes.

A book exhibition presenting the books by President Gurbanguly Berdimuhamedov and numerous publications about Turkmenistan, ancient history and culture and modern achievements of our country, was arranged in the framework of the scientific conference “Turkmenistan-China: the Great Silk Road – the Road of Friendship and Cooperation”, which was held in the conference hall of the Dungan Studies Centre at the China Central University for Nationalities.
